From Kilograms to Pounds: A Simple Conversion, Complex Implications



First things first: let's get the units sorted. 2000 kilograms equates to approximately 4409.2 pounds (1 kilogram is roughly 2.2 pounds). This seemingly simple conversion opens a window into the practical realities of handling such a significant weight. Imagine transporting this much weight across continents – the fuel consumption, the structural integrity of the transport vehicle, and even the potential wear and tear on roads all come into play. A single shipping container might easily hold this much weight, but transporting it across rough terrain would necessitate a specialized, heavy-duty truck, or potentially multiple smaller vehicles. Consider a large-scale construction project – 2000 kilos could represent a significant portion of a day's concrete pour or a sizable shipment of steel reinforcements.

The Industrial Impact: Manufacturing and Logistics



In the manufacturing sector, 2000 kilos is a significant quantity. Think about the production of automotive parts, where this weight could represent a large batch of engine blocks, or in the food industry, a substantial harvest of grain. The efficient movement and storage of this quantity require sophisticated logistical systems. Warehouses need to have floors capable of withstanding the weight, forklifts need to be appropriately rated, and transportation routes need to be carefully planned to ensure safety and efficiency. This also influences the cost of production and distribution, impacting the final price of the goods. For example, a company transporting 2000kg of delicate electronics will have significantly higher insurance and handling costs compared to transporting the same weight of sand.

Beyond the Practical: Engineering and Structural Considerations



The weight of 2000 kilos also has significant implications for engineering and structural design. Buildings, bridges, and other infrastructure need to be designed to support such loads. Failure to account for this weight can have catastrophic consequences. For example, a crane lifting 2000 kilos needs to be properly rated to handle the weight and the associated stresses. Similarly, a building's floor needs to be designed to support this weight without buckling or collapsing. The design specifications must also account for dynamic loads – the impact of sudden movement or acceleration – further increasing the complexity of the engineering problem.

Expert-Level FAQs:



1. What are the key factors influencing the cost of transporting 2000 kilos of goods internationally? Cost is determined by distance, mode of transport (sea, air, land), the type of goods (requiring special handling or refrigeration), insurance, customs duties, and fuel costs. Fluctuations in fuel prices can significantly impact the overall expense.

2. How does the density of the material affect the handling and transportation of a 2000-kilo load? High-density materials (like metals) occupy less space than low-density materials (like feathers), influencing the choice of transport. A smaller volume is easier to handle, while a larger volume might necessitate different loading techniques and potentially larger vehicles.

3. What are the critical safety regulations surrounding the lifting and movement of a 2000-kilo load? Regulations vary by region but generally involve operator licensing, equipment inspections (cranes, forklifts), load securing methods, and adherence to weight limits and safe working practices. Ignoring these can lead to severe accidents.

4. How does the 2000-kilo weight impact the structural design of a warehouse or storage facility? The design must consider not only the static load (the weight itself) but also dynamic loads (movement of the load), and potential localized stress points. This involves detailed calculations and engineering analysis to ensure structural integrity.

5. What are the environmental implications of transporting 2000 kilos of goods over long distances? The primary impact is increased carbon emissions from fuel consumption. The choice of transport mode (ship vs. air) greatly affects the carbon footprint. Strategies for reducing environmental impact include optimizing routes, using more fuel-efficient vehicles, and exploring alternative transportation methods.
